Heard varying opinions on mufflers, Flowmaster vs Magnaflow. I've got a 77 L-48 with shorty headers, 2 1/2 pipes and I'm looking for a deep throaty type sound but don't want to go deaf on the inside. Any opinions out there?

Deep and throaty = Magnaflows
Loud and resonating = Flowmasters
I have had both. My ears prefer Magnas no question. Others prefer Flows. You really need to listen to both to know what you'll like because it's ALL subjective.
i got flows on this 76 i am working on and to be honest i am real disappointed in the sound - cant explain it but like Durango says - resonating and maybe a little high pitched. Flows really sound their best when they are further towards the engine to mid way in the system - not at the very back. they are loud, too.

I prefer the more mellow sound of a Turbo Muffler as well, we went Dynomax Turbos and it sounds great IMHO, added a cross pipe and it really smoothed the sound out.
